西安交通大学9月课程考试Java语言程序设计作业考核试题 下载本文

内容发布更新时间 : 2024/11/10 17:54:44星期一 下面是文章的全部内容请认真阅读。

【奥鹏】[西安交通大学]西安交通大学18年9月课程考试《Java语言程序设计》作业考核试题

试卷总分:100 得分:100

第1题,在Java中用什么关键字修饰的方法可以直接通过类名来调用?() A、static B、final C、private D、void

第2题,编译Java源程序文件将产生相应的字节码文件,这些字节码文件的扩展名为()。 A、.byte B、.class C、.html D、.exe

第3题,Java语言中,int类型在内存中所占的位数为 ( ) A、8 B、16 C、32 D、64

第4题,下列不是数据库完整性规则的是____。 A、实体完整性 B、参照完整性 C、数据完整性 D、用户定义完整性

第5题,Application对象中____函数获取文件的绝对路径。 A、path() B、getpath() C、getRealPath() D、getPath()

第6题,在创建对象时必须()

A、先声明对象,然后才能使用对象

B、先声明对象,为对象分配内存空间,然后才能使用对象

C、先声明对象,为对象分配内存空间,对对象初始化,然后才能使用对象 D、上述说法都对

第7题,下列不是服务器脚本语言的是____。 A、ASP B、JSP C、PHP D、VC++

第8题,下列不是 InputStream 子类的是____。 A、文件输入流 FileInputStream B、对象输入流 ObjectInputStream C、字符输入流 FilterInputStream D、压缩文件输入流 ZipInputStream

第9题,下列不可作为java语言标识符的是() A、a1 B、$1 C、_1 D、11

第10题,类声明中,声明抽象类的关键字是 ( ) A、public B、abstract C、final D、class

第11题,下列哪个选项不是Java语言的特点?() A、面向对象 B、高安全性 C、平台无关 D、面向过程

第12题,System.out.println(\的输出结果应该是()。 A、52 B、7 C、2 D、5

第13题,在调用方法时,若要使方法改变实参的值,可以() A、用基本数据类型作为参数 B、用对象作为参数 C、A和B都对 D、A和B都不对

第14题,____函数完成文件重命名。 A、compareTo() B、renameTo()

C、createNewFile() D、delete()

第15题,执行语句int i=1,j=++i;后i与j的值分别为()。 A、1与1 B、2与1 C、1与2 D、2与2

第16题,Character流与Byte流的区别是() A、每次读入的字节数不同 B、前者带有缓冲,后者没有

C、前者是字符读写,后者是字节读写 D、二者没有区别,可以互换使用

第17题,下列哪个命令中,用来运行Java程序的是 ( )

A、java B、javadoc C、jar D、javac

第18题,一个Unicode字符占用 ( ) A、8位 B、16位 C、32位 D、一个字节

第19题,Socket对象中____函数获取远程端口。 A、getPort( )

B、getLocalPort( ) C、getRemotePort( ) D、getHost( )

第20题,public class Person{ int arr[]=new int[10]; public static void main(String args[]){ System.out.println(arr[1]); } } 正确的说法是 A、编译时将产生错误

B、编译时正确,运行时将产生错误 C、输出零 D、输出空

第21题,下列哪个命令中,用来编译Java程序的是( ) A、java B、javadoc C、jar D、javac

第22题,Java的字符类型采用的是Unicode编码方案,每个Unicode码占用()个比特位。 A、8 B、16 C、32

D、64

第23题,以下关于继承的叙述正确的是()。 A、在Java中类只允许单一继承

B、在Java中一个类只能实现一个接口

C、在Java中一个类不能同时继承一个类和实现一个接口 D、在Java中接口只允许单一继承

第24题,如果程序编译通过,可运行,但运行结果与期望不相符,这类错误成为____ A、语义错误 B、运行错误 C、语法错误 D、逻辑错误

第25题,Java中()

A、一个子类可以有多个父类,一个父类也可以有多个子类 B、一个子类可以有多个父类,但一个父类只可以有一个子类 C、一个子类可以有一个父类,但一个父类可以有多个子类 D、上述说法都不对

第26题,Java程序的种类有() A、类(Class) B、Applet

C、Application D、Servlet ,C,D

第27题,下列说法错误的有()

A、在类方法中可用this来调用本类的类方法 B、在类方法中调用本类的类方法时可直接调用 C、在类方法中只能调用本类中的类方法 D、在类方法中绝对不能调用实例方法 ,C,D